The G-4 Wash-Beam is a fast and compact wash moving light capable of outstanding color rendering and a sharp defined beam angle. The optical system is designed to deliver a high-quality color mix with an accurate and precise beam of light. Because of its remarkable output, wide zoom range, qualified color reproduction, accurate color temperature control, and low power consumption, the G-4 Wash-Beam is a very flexible moving light suitable for any application.
LED Technology
The G-4 Wash-Beam is the first moving head able to achieve a coherent and qualified light spectrum in all color temperatures by only using 5 colored LEDs. This is possible because of the combination between RGBAM additive mixing, included Micro-Fresnel lens and precise SGM firmware. The LEDs expected lifetime is 50,000 hours.
Colors
This small but powerful fixture includes RGB mixing in its lightsource with additional amber and mint LEDs to fill the typical gaps of a LED spectrum offering rich whites in all different color temperatures. Through the Color Emulation DMX channel, it is possible to match most of the colors present in the LEE catalog and to output only the amber or the mint LEDs. A plus/minus green function is also included for accurate color control in TV and film shootings.
Optics
Because of its brilliant optical performance, the G-4 Wash-Beam delivers unique features. Its zoom range goes from 4.8° to 34°º with smooth transition and no color shifts. The optical system is designed so maximum output is achieved in the 15º - 18º zoom range, instead of 4.8º beam angle. By doing this, the G-4 Wash-Beam achieves the best light output for its size, which is also the natural beam angle for this kind of moving head.
Micro-Fresnel behavior
The G-4 Wash-Beam uses a Micro-Fresnel front lens capable of a bright light output while delivering a similar performance of the traditional Plano-Convex lenses. As a PC-like luminaire, the G-4 Wash-Beam creates sharp defined shadows in flood position, and diffuse silhouettes in spot position with a visible and a clearly defined beam of light.
Full control via Studio Mode
The G-4 Wash-Beam includes the powerful SGM DMX Studio Mode, expanding its capabilities through a number of advanced features. Select different dimming curves, choose your preferred RGB CTC, RGBAM, CMY, HSI or XY color mode, adjust fan speed to reduce noise, change the LED frequency rate, and increase or reduce the peaks of green in the white output. IP rating
The durable IP65-rating of the G-4 Wash-Beam luminaire ensures that the fixture is kept free of externally induced particles and liquids on internal optics and light sources, such as smoke fluid, dust, dirt, airborne pollution, and humidity. Thereby, the need to clean optics is eliminated and no internal corrosion will occur. It is ideal for outdoor applications, while being practically maintenance-free making it a sustainable and long-lasting choice for indoor events and installations as well.
Dehumidification
The internal built-in dehumidifier protects this fixture from moisture, pollution and any other factors that can generate corrosion. The patented SGM dehumidification not only removes humidity but also prevents oxidation and condensation, while a gore-tex membrane equalizes internal pressure to prevent leaks. Photometrics
The G-4 Wash-Beam is able to reach 8190 luxes at 5m distance with an excellent white and only 200W. This is one of the many benefits of using RGBAM color mixing, a Wash-Beam front lens, and accurate color calibration. In RAW mode, the G-4 Wash-Beam outputs a color temperature close to 7,000K with a CRI, TLCI, and CQS above 90, but these numbers are also in a similar range while using 5,600K or 3,200K in calibrated RGB mixing. Linear 2000K - 10000K CT control is also provided.
Interchangeable lens
With the addition of an optional interchangeable Fresnel lens, the G-4 Wash-Beam can easily be transformed into a G-4 Wash. The optional Motorized Barndoors lens module with individual DMX control can also be attached to the luminaire. For theatrical purposes, the G-4 Wash and the G-4 Wash Motorized Barndoors act like a regular fresnel light, while the G-4 Wash-Beam lens emulates the performance of a Plano-Convex projector.
Thermal management
To achieve optimum performance of the LEDs at all times, this bright and accurate luminaire is optimized to manage heat impact through SGM's unique thermal management technology. The technology consists of a uniquely designed body and heat sink, which ensures optimal cooling of the LED chips. Additionally, the special aluminum alloy and surface treatment ensures maximum heat dispersion while the fan-assisted cooling ensures optimal performance at any time and under any conditions (such as variable temperatures, limited airflows, confined installation spaces, etc.).

Mounting options
There are many mounting options available in the G-4 Wash-Beam. It can be rigged by using the included easy-fit omega bracket with ¼ turn fasteners, it can be installed in any kind of floor thanks to its integrated rubber feet, or it can be mounted with a special ceiling mount to eliminate the need of the base.
Included SGM technologies
ThermalDriveTM
This thermal management techonology provides Advaced Temperature Control monitored via sensors and software, keeping optimal LED junction temperatures, and ensuring maximum reliability for long-term use. SGM's predictive color mixing algorithm compesates the decay levels of color-based LEDs for superior color rendering. Finally, the ThermalDriveTM system includes cutting-edge heat removal via passive thermal tecniques and active forced-air cooling (depending on the product), specifically designed to maintain LED efficiency while extending fixture's lifetime.
TruColorTM
SGM uses Full Range Calibration in all LED fixtures over CIE space and black body curve, measured via spectrometer and SGM Illumination Lab software. The consistency of each product and its lifetime expectancy is monitored throught inbuilt sensors to compensate color shifting and to allow color temperature re-calibration. To provide the best user experience, SGM's Color Match procedure ensures accurate wavelength reproduction within the product range via colored LEDs, dichroic filters, or CMY mixing (depending on the product); all of them specified to match the SGM color palette.
DryTechTM
SGM's integrated patented Dehumidification process eliminates humidity and breaks down corrosive H2SO4 molecules deriving from polluted air to avoid destructive corrosion. Inbuilt dehumidifiers constantly remove trapped hydrogen from inside of the lighting fixture in a solid estate electrolytic process with no moving parts. The DryTechTM procedure is also based on a Ingress Protection rating of 65 or 66 (depending on the fixture), intended as a full protection against dust and other particles, while ensuring protection against direct water jets.
